DC Poonch Asked to Expedite DPRs for Bunker Construction in Border Areas

Poonch, June 17 (JKNS): The Jammu and Kashmir Government has directed the Deputy Commissioner of Poonch to immediately prepare Detailed Project Reports (DPRs) for the construction of safety bunkers in vulnerable and shelling-affected areas of the district to ensure the safety of civilians.

In a formal communique from the Civil Secretariat, the Office of the Hon’ble Deputy Chief Minister of Jammu & Kashmir has instructed the Deputy Commissioner Poonch to initiate immediate steps for the construction of safety bunkers in the vulnerable and shelling-affected areas of the district.

According to the communique from J&K Deputy Chief Minister’s office to DC Poonch, a copy of which lies with news agency JKNS stated that the direction comes in response to a delegation led by Shri Ajaz Ahmad Jan, Hon’ble MLA Haveli Poonch, which met with the Deputy Chief Minister and expressed concern over the urgent requirement of safety bunkers for the protection of civilian lives and property in areas frequently targeted by cross-border shelling.

The recent incidents of shelling have severely impacted public life and created an atmosphere of fear and uncertainty among residents in border areas.

“In view of the safety of the general public, it is requested that immediate steps be taken for the preparation of Detailed Project Reports (DPRs) for construction of bunkers in the identified vulnerable locations without any delay,” the communique reads.

The directions follows a delegation led by MLA Ajaz Ahmad Jan, who highlighted the urgent need for protective structures after heavy shelling between May 7–10.

The said week saw escalated tensions following India’s Operation Sindoor carried out in response to the Pahalgam terror attack which triggered intense tensions between India and Pakistan. (JKNS)
